Mastercard is seeking a Director of Program Management to lead strategic and business-critical programs within the Transfer Solutions business. The successful candidate will manage junior team members and collaborate with internal and external stakeholders including vendors and regulators. This role demands strong leadership, negotiation, and communication skills to oversee program activities such as requirement gathering, budgeting, and vendor engagement, ensuring projects are delivered on time and within budget.
